Decision-Making Framework
Skill vs Agent Decision
- Use Skill: Reusable utility, template generation, validation, formatting, simple transformations
- Use Agent: Multi-step workflows, decision trees, complex analysis, orchestration across tools
- Rule: If it requires deep reasoning or multiple phases, it's an agent not a skill
Script Complexity
- Simple bash script: Single purpose, < 50 lines, clear inputs/outputs
- Complex orchestration: Multiple scripts, conditional logic, error recovery
- External tool integration: Leverage existing CLIs rather than reimplementing
Template Design
- Static templates: Fixed structure with variable substitution
- Dynamic templates: Conditional sections based on parameters
- Multi-file templates: Template sets for complete features

SKILL.md File Structure (EXACT FORMAT):
---
name: skill-name
description: What it does. Use when triggering contexts.
allowed-tools: Tool1, Tool2
---
# Skill Title (comes AFTER frontmatter)
Rest of content...
NEVER generate:
# Skill Title ← ❌ THIS BREAKS THE FILE!
---
name: skill-name
...
